Wooden Canoe Paddle - Ash Blade with Maple Shaft from China

This canoe paddle features a lightweight ash wood blade for optimal water displacement and a durable maple shaft for comfortable grip and strength. Classified under HTS 4421.99.88.00 as it is specifically designed as a canoe paddle, an other article of wood not elsewhere specified in Chapter 44. The natural wood construction provides buoyancy and responsiveness essential for recreational paddling.

Import Tips

Verify the paddle is specifically designed for canoes with blade shape and shaft ergonomics to justify 4421.99.88.00 classification; generic oars may fall elsewhere

Include detailed invoices specifying wood species (e.g

ash, maple) and confirming no metal reinforcements exceeding minor fittings to avoid reclassification

Obtain CITES certification if using restricted species like certain maples; test for moisture content under 20% to prevent pest-related holds at entry
